So, Imagina is this intriguing blend of drama, horror, and thriller that really plays with the mind. The tone is heavy, almost suffocating at times, which adds to that unsettling atmosphere. You know, it’s not just jump scares—it’s more about the tension that builds slowly. The pacing is deliberate, which might throw some viewers, but it really gives you time to absorb the characters’ turmoil. The practical effects are noteworthy; they have a rawness that feels gritty, enhancing the horror element. The performances—though the cast is relatively unknown—are surprisingly strong, drawing you in with their emotional depth. It’s a unique exploration of fear and reality, and it definitely leaves you pondering after the credits roll.
